Maximize Space with Woodland-Inspired Kids Room Design

Woodland-inspired kids room with children drawing and floral decor.

Create a Woodland Oasis for Your Kids

Transforming a child's room into a woodland-inspired space can ignite creativity and bring the beauty of nature indoors. This design trend not only captivates young adventurers but also fosters a tranquil atmosphere that encourages imaginative play. From using earthy color palettes—such as greens, browns, and soft pastels—to incorporating natural materials like wood, rattan, and cotton, it’s all about creating a serene environment that feels like a cozy nook in the forest.

Small Space Ideas for Big Dreams

Young families, urban dwellers, and those living in tiny homes will appreciate how to maximize square footage even in the smallest of spaces. Consider multi-functional furniture; a bed with built-in storage or a desk that doubles as a play area can cleverly optimize the room’s functionality while maintaining its woodland charm. Stylish storage baskets made from natural fibers can keep toys organized and accessible, fostering both tidiness and playfulness.

Emphasizing Nature with Décor

Natural elements should take center stage in any woodland-themed room. Decorate the walls with nature-inspired artwork or wallpaper featuring trees, animals, or starry skies. Integrating plants, like a small potted fern or hanging vines, can purify the air and add a vibrant touch. For even more creativity, consider DIY projects, such as making leaf prints or designing tree branches to hang as decor. It’s fun, engaging, and adds a personal touch to the room!

Creating a Playful Atmosphere

A woodland-inspired kids’ space should encourage exploration and imagination. Soft area rugs resembling grass or wooden floors can create a play area that feels warm and inviting. Add whimsical touches, like fairy lights strung overhead or stuffed animals arranged as woodland creatures, to spark children's imaginations and make their space a true sanctuary of adventure.

Conclusion: Crafting Cozy Shelters

Embarking on a woodland-inspired room design not only supports creativity and playfulness but also gives parents the chance to teach children about nature and minimalism. In today’s compact living environment, seamlessly embedding style with function can make every inch count. Whether it’s through space-saving furniture or thoughtful décor choices, you have the power to create a beautiful, functional haven for your child.

Discover How a Family Built Their Dream Skoolie for $40,000

Update Building the Grand Dame: A Dream Turned Reality When Matt and Morgan set out to convert a 2003 school bus into their family home, they weren't just chasing an adventure; they were crafting a lifestyle anchored in freedom and family. This journey began years earlier on a sailboat stationed in Australia, and their experiences aboard fueled their passion for travel and self-sufficiency. With the arrival of their baby, Ruby, the couple recognized the need for a cozy, affordable, and flexible home, leading them to the decision to create the Grand Dame, their skoolie. Skoolie Conversion: A Budget-Friendly Family Home Completed in just four months and for a remarkable budget of around $40,000, the Grand Dame is a testament to the couple's ingenuity and hard work. While Matt took charge of heavy carpentry tasks, Morgan tapped into her creative side, especially in the bathroom, where she meticulously laid tiles and applied micro cement. There is something deeply fulfilling about building a home that can be both a family sanctuary and a nomadic lifestyle without sacrificing comfort or style. Inspiring Off-Grid Tiny Living with Functionality The Grand Dame isn't just breathtaking in design; it's a functional off-grid living solution equipped with six high-efficiency solar panels and a robust inverter system powering all their needs, from air conditioning to cooking. Their daily use of appliances relies entirely on solar energy, showcasing what’s possible with intent and efficient planning. Family-friendly choices, like storage solutions primarily in drawers for safety, ensure that this tiny home doesn't just fit their lifestyle but enhances it. Thoughtful Design for Family Needs Beyond aesthetics, each corner of the Grand Dame reflects thoughtful family living. From a mural symbolizing Ruby's name to practical features like a baby height-tracking wall and a hammock for naps, the design preserves the family’s love for adventure while ensuring it caters to their needs. The composting toilet and versatile garage for tools complete the functionality of this tiny living space. Such details underscore the seamless blend of comfort, creativity, and practicality. Embracing Minimalist Living on the Road For those considering a similar path, the Grand Dame serves as a significant source of inspiration for sustainable tiny living and efficient space usage. From strategic downsizing tips to adopting minimalist living principles, Matt and Morgan’s story demonstrates that embracing a small footprint can lead to a deeply fulfilling life focused on experiences rather than possessions. Their success—crafted through careful planning and hands-on labor—reminds us that home is not just a place but a way of being, paving the way for a future where people value freedom, adventure, and connection over materialism.
